Is Pick to Voice different than Voice Picking? At their core, both refer to the technology of using voice to automate order picking in the warehouse. The goal is to use voice to help speed the product fulfillment process. While these two terms have similar meanings, voice technology has changed since the phrase \u201cpick-to-voice\u201d was popularized. Using voice automation in the warehouse has evolved to be applicable to many other workflows, with picking just one of many applications that can be voice enabled today. Processes inside and outside the four walls are all candidates for optimized voice directed productivity. A voice picking system is typically used to improve a picking workflow that integrates with the warehouse management system (WMS). <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>While voice activated order picking is generic terminology, diving deeper we find the picking processes that each company implements have been optimized for their products in their supply chain. For instance, the picking processes might include each picking, case picking, zone picking, directed picking, pick-n-pack. In addition to a variety of order picking methodologies \u2013 all of which can be supported with modern voice picking software \u2013 additional applications are ideal for voice automated workflows. We automate repeatable user actions, what I like to call <strong>\u201celiminating the dead processes\u201d <\/strong>where interaction from the team is not necessary. This includes automating actions such as pressing buttons on the mobile device, automatically populating data to form fields where relationships are constant. The ability to include this automation with the speech-to-text and text-to-speech, as part of the same process \u2013 this is the magic combination.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Let me give you an example. For a food manufacturing receiving process, the original process was to receive 50 different pallets of the same raw ingredient, which, per the WMS workflow required the receiver to complete the same form each time, for each pallet. This would generate a unique LPN to keep track of the unique pallet ID. AccuSpeechMobile introduced voice commands and responses for the receiving workflow, coupled with automation which is programmed to receive the number of pallets indicated by the receiver as the same raw ingredient, and automatically generate the unique LPN\u2019s 50 times. So, instead of receiving 50 different pallets of the same ingredient and filling out the form individually \u2013 it\u2019s now a single voice command. This adhered to all internal system requirements, significantly reduced the time spent on receiving and improved accuracy as well as employee job satisfaction, and it\u2019s implemented entirely on the mobile device.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h4 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>How do you think AccuSpeechMobile\u2019s voice solution helps DC managers deal with the labor shortage?<\/strong><\/h4>\n\n\n\n<p>This continues to be an important consideration and top of mind for managers of the order fulfillment process.
